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Pawnee). They took their contest on Thursday with ease, bagging a 72-23 victory over the Quapaw Wildcats. The Black Bears haven't had any issues with the Wildcats recently, as the game was their third consecutive win against them.
Pawnee's victory bumped their record up to 5-2. As for Quapaw, they now have a losing record of 3-4.
